I'd say you need more dreads, lots more. Also, when dividing the hair up for an install, try making the sections smaller at the top and a little larger towards the bottom of your hairline. This means more dreads up top where everyone can see, and fewer dreads on bottom where people can't really see. That way when you have your long, luscious red dreads down most of your scalp will be hidden.
